Recipe adapted by Ina Garten
Ingredients:
1-3/4 cups all purpose flour
2 cups sugar
2 tsp baking soda
1 tsp baking powder
1 tsp kosher salt
1 tsp vanilla extract
1 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
1 cup strong, freshly brewed coffee
2 eggs @ room temperature
1 cup buttermilk
1/2 cup vegetable oil
Directions:
Preheat your oven to 350º F. Combine your wet ingredients (buttermilk, eggs, vegetable oil, vanilla) in a bowl. In your mixer bowl (separate) combine the dry ingredients (flour, sugar, cocoa powder, baking soda, salt, baking powder) and mix on low speed for a minute. Then slowly pour in the wet ingredients bowl, adding to the dry mix in the mixer bowl. Let it come together (don't overmix) and add the coffee. Fill a cupcake pan with liners and transfer the batter into a measuring cup or pitcher for easy pouring. Fill the liner cups 3/4 or 2/3 the way up and bake for 13-16 minutes. Toothpick test the cupcakes and if they're done (toothpick comes out clean) let them cook for 10 minutes before applying frosting. Enjoy and don't forget to share this video!
*makes 2 dozen cupcakes
